How can I increase the impact factor of my journal?

Page 9: Scientific journals: raising profiles, prospects, and impact factors

Profiles, prospects, and impact factors

• Call for papers (too passive)

• Active commissioning

• Appeal to senior authors who no longer need a high IF

• Relaunch or redesign – change or add new focus

• Explain why this journal

• Call in favors

• Beg!

What do Thomson Reuters want?

• Informative title

• Named authors

• An abstract

• Data or other new scientific information

• Citation section

• Regular publication schedule

• Issues published on time

• Ethical editorial policies

Page 23: Scientific journals: raising profiles, prospects, and impact factors

• Counted Research papers of all kinds Reviews

• Not counted Editorials News Letters to the Editor

BUT, if an editorial, news items, letters to the Editor, or similar materials are cited, they are added to the numerator, so increasing the IF

The BEST way to increase the IF is to publish excellent scientific articles that other scientists will cite

But also remember• Reviews receive more citations than research papers

• Longer articles receive more citations than shorter articles

• Articles in open access journals receive more (?) citations

sooner

• Editorials and overviews – “best papers last year”

Profiles, prospects, and impact factors

Page 25: Scientific journals: raising profiles, prospects, and impact factors

Bad strategies for increasing IF

• Editors ‘invite’ authors of submitted articles

to cite papers in their journal

• Editors discourage authors from citing

papers in a rival journal

• Don’t be tempted to allow the IF to dictate your content
